cooling system upgrades in the doka

swapping the #t3 doka cooling system from the butchered early style to factory fresh late style … pulled out this much piping from the engine bay so far …

the doka is ‘early style’ but has a later MV installed and the old and new style has been butchered together – meaning that both sides of the heater core are having water ‘pushed’ to them (hence no heating) and the radiator is refusing to bleed properly to get airlocks out of the system….

so order up complete new sets of water pipes, junctions, clamps, hoses and a new water distribution block, upper bleed rail and assorted pieces and start ripping the old perished stuff out –

there is a small amount of trimming in the firewall to do but the result is fresh, new, more efficient and the later style cooling system is better engineered and actually holds some number of litres more coolant – which is nice…
